  • In this video, I show you how to paint your headlight housing. On the VW, it comes stock chrome, and I want to black it out to give it a bit more contrast.
    So if you have a set of reflector bowls that are chrome, you should leave them chrome so you don’t distort your light output. The only time you can paint them is if you are doing a headlight retrofit and you are installing a projector lens in that bowl, similar to the lens I have on my Accord.
    It isn’t a bad idea to look into an additional set of headlights to do this procedure to, so that if you damage your headlights for whatever reason, your daily driver is not out of commission. You can usually find a set at your local scrap yard, eBay, or even amazon for pretty cheap.
